引言

在近年来,区块链技术的迅猛发展推动了数字货币的普及,区块链钱包作为存储和管理数字货币的重要工具,受到了越来越多用户的关注。区块链钱包不仅提供了存储和交易数字资产的功能,还涉及到以安全性和隐私性的保护等一系列复杂的理论和方法。然而,了解区块链钱包的计算方法,能够帮助用户更好地选择和使用这一金融工具,确保其资产的安全并充分享受其带来的便利。

什么是区块链钱包?

深入探讨区块链钱包的计算方法:从理论到实践

区块链钱包是一个数字化的工具,通过它用户可以存储、接收和发送数字货币。不同于传统钱包,区块链钱包并不存储实际的货币,而是存储与数字货币相关的公钥和私钥。公钥类似于账户号码,而私钥则被视为密码,用户需要保护好私钥以确保其资金安全。

根据存储方式的不同,区块链钱包可以分为热钱包与冷钱包。热钱包通常在线,方便用户进行日常交易,而冷钱包则离线存储,适合长期存储和保护大额资产。

区块链钱包的计算方法概述

区块链钱包的计算方法主要涉及加密技术、哈希函数、密钥生成等几个方面。

1. 加密技术

区块链钱包的安全性依赖于加密技术。用户的私钥通过某种加密算法生成,确保其在网络中传输时不被他人窃取。常见的加密算法有RSA、DSA以及椭圆曲线加密(ECC)等。这些算法为用户的数据安全提供了一层保护。

2. 哈希函数

哈希函数用于将输入的信息(例如交易信息)转换成固定长度的哈希值。在区块链中,哈希值不仅用于检查数据的完整性,还能联系到区块链的每一个块,从而形成一个不可篡改的链条。常见的哈希函数有SHA-256和RIPEMD-160等。

3. 密钥生成

密钥的生成是一个重要过程,通常通过随机数生成器来生成一个安全的私钥,随后使用数学算法(如椭圆曲线算法)来生成对应的公钥。密钥对的安全性至关重要,因为任何能够获取用户私钥的人都可以无限制地访问其数字资产。

区块链钱包的实现和使用

深入探讨区块链钱包的计算方法:从理论到实践

区块链钱包可以通过软件和硬件的形式实现。

1. 软件钱包

软件钱包可分为桌面钱包、移动钱包和网页钱包。桌面钱包需要在个人电脑上安装,它提供了更好的安全性但不如热钱包便携;移动钱包则安装在智能手机上,方便用户随时随地进行交易;网页钱包则提供即时的访问,但相对来说可能更容易受到攻击。

2. 硬件钱包

硬件钱包是一种专用设备,安全性高且适合长期存储大量数字货币。它通过将私钥存储在专用硬件中,并通过USB或蓝牙等方式连接到计算机上进行交易,从而降低了黑客攻击的风险。

与区块链钱包相关的常见问题

1. 如何选择合适的区块链钱包?

选择一个合适的区块链钱包需要综合考虑多个因素,包括安全性、方便性、支持的数字货币种类、费用等。用户应该了解不同钱包的优缺点,例如热钱包虽然使用方便,但安全性较低,而冷钱包虽然安全,但使用起来不够便捷。

对于初学者,建议可以先从热钱包入手,逐步了解区块链的运作机制,之后再考虑转向冷钱包进行资产的长期存储。同时,需要时常关注钱包开发者的信誉和安全漏洞的修复情况,确保所选钱包的安全性。

2. 区块链钱包被盗了怎么办?

如果用户发现自己的区块链钱包被盗,首先要保持冷静。需要立即更改与钱包相关的所有密码,并联系钱包服务商,了解是否能采取进一步措施。同时,需要检查自己的私钥和助记词是否泄露,如果泄露,可能需要考虑将其他资产转移到新的安全钱包中。

为了防止未来发生类似事件,用户应定期备份钱包,使用强密码,启用双重认证,并时刻关注网络安全动态,增强安全意识。

3. 什么是多重签名钱包?

多重签名钱包,顾名思义,需要多个私钥才能进行交易。这种钱包提供了一层额外的安全性,尤其适合企业或团队共同管理资产的场景。在有多个签名的情况下,即使一个私钥被盗,黑客也无法独立授权交易。

设置多重签名钱包通常需要规划好签名的方式,比如三分之二的签名要求、两名签名者等。使用多重签名钱包,可以有效降低资产被盗的风险,并在管理资产时增加透明度。

4. 区块链钱包是否完全匿名?

区块链钱包的匿名性取决于多种因素。一般来说,区块链网络是公开的,而钱包的地址可以被追踪,因此完全的匿名是很难实现的。不过,有些钱包提供了隐私保护功能,通过混合技术和代理服务增强用户的匿名性。

为了提高交易的隐私性,用户可选择隐私币如门罗币(Monero)和达世币(Dash),这些币种设计上就考虑了用户隐私的保护。此外,用户在使用钱包时应避免将钱包地址和个人身份信息关联,增加交易的匿名性。

5. 如何备份区块链钱包?

备份区块链钱包至关重要,因为这直接关系到用户资产的安全性。用户可以通过多种方式进行备份,包括导出私钥、助记词以及钱包文件等。不同类型钱包备份的方法有所不同,但普遍而言,强烈建议使用硬件存储设备(如U盘)进行离线备份,以确保不被黑客攻击。

用户应该妥善保存备份文件的安全性,避免因遗失或被盗造成余额损失。定期进行备份也是好习惯,特别是在进行大额交易前或重要更新时。

总结

区块链钱包的计算方法涉及加密、哈希、密钥生成等多个领域,用户需对这些内容有一定了解,才能保障自己的数字资产安全。希望通过本文的探讨能够为读者在区块链技术的学习与应用中提供一些帮助。

无论您是区块链新手还是经验丰富的用户,正确使用钱包并理解相关原理,都将对保障您的资产和交易的安全起到至关重要的作用。